HSI TRAINING SYSTEM REFRIGERATION AND AIR CONDITIONING TECHNOLOGY, BASE UNIT
The base unit is, dependent on the objective of the experiment, extended into complete refrigeration circuit with one of the models available as accessories refrigerator, refrigeration system with refrigeration and freezing stage, simple air conditioning system, air conditioning).
All components are arranged well visible to allow their operation to be monitored. The modern and powerful software is an integral part of the training system in the form of hardware/software integration (HSI). It enables the comfortable execution and analysis of the experiments. The experimental unit is connected to the PC via a USB interface.
The software consists of a software for system operation and for data acquisition and an educational software. With explanatory texts and illustrations the educational software significantly aids the understanding of the theoretical principles. With the aid of an authoring system, the teacher can create further exercises. Each model has its own software matching the learning objectives.
Temperatures and pressures in the system are recorded by sensors and displayed dynamically in the software for system operation and data acquisition. The effect of parameter changes can be tracked in log p-h and h-x diagrams. The system is also operated via the software.

Specification
Basic experiments on the operation of refrigeration and air conditioning systems by combining the base unit and models
Training system with HSI technology
Condensing unit consisting of compressor, condenser and receiver
Connection between condensing unit and model via refrigerant hoses
Model attached securely on HIS Training System with fasteners
Manometer for refrigerant with temperature scale
Refrigerant R134a, CFC-free
System control via solenoid valves and software
Functions of the software: educational software, data acquisition, system operation
